What is the value of the expression 9x^2-12x+4 when x=3

Answer:

49

Step-by-step explanation:

When x=3,

= 9x^2-12x+4

= 9(3)^2-12(3)+4

=81-36+4

=49

49 points, will give Brainliest! Having a lot of trouble with Determining the domains of functions. Khan Academy Algebra I.

Domains of functions are the values that <em>can</em> be plugged into the function and not "break" it. By "break" I mean that the denominator cannot be 0, in this case. If the denominator is 0, we will get a divide by 0 error, and thus, we must restrict the domain. All values of x will work except 9/4:

\frac{7-3x}{4x-9}

Let's plug in 9/4 and see what happens:

\frac{7-3(\frac{9}{4})}{4(\frac{9}{4})-9}   = \frac{whatever}{0}

So, plugging in 9/4 results in denominator equalling 0. Therefore, we must restrict the domain so that x ≠ 9/4. Your answer is All real values of x such that x ≠ 9/4.

A sprinkler system is designed to water 5/8 acre of land in 1/4 hour. How many acres of land can it water in 1 hour?

5/8 acre of land ... 1/4 hour
x acres of land = ? ... 1 hour

If you would like to know how many acres of land can the sprinkler system water in 1 hour, you can calculate this using the following steps:

5/8 * 1 = 1/4 * x
5/8 = 1/4 * x       /*4
x = 5/8 * 4
x = 5/2 = 2.5 = 2 1/2 acres of land

The correct result would be 2 1/2 acres of land.

In △ABC, m∠A=27 °, c=14 , and m∠B=25 °. Find a to the nearest tenth.

Answer:

a = 8.1

Step-by-step explanation:

Firstly, since we have a triangle, automatically, we have 3 interior angles

Mathematically the sum of these angles = 180

A + B + C = 180

27 + 25 + C = 180

52 + C = 180

C = 180-52

C = 128

We use the sine rule to find a

The sine rule posits that the ratio of a side to the sine of the angle facing that side is equal for all the sides of a triangle

Thus, mathematically according to the sine rule;

c/Sin C = a/Sin A

14/sin 128 = a/sin 27

a = 14sin27/sin 128 = 8.0657

which to the nearest tenth is 8.1
